PREMIER'S PERSONAL SEWING KIT

H1989.336

Sewing kit containing one green plastic thimble, nine small reels of coloured cotton (all different), a small plastic pouch containing two needles, four buttons, two small safety pins and a needle threader, and a small pair of scissors with orange plastic handles. The kit is contained in a plastic box, black on the bottom and clear on top. Inside the lid is a piece of white paper with 'The Premier's / Personal / Sewing Kit' printed in blue. On the inside of the lid the paper reads 'With Compliments' and inside a box 'Australian Labor Party' with and Australian flag.
